Calling card may refer to:
- Visiting card, a card used socially to signify a visit made to a house if the occupant is absent, or as an introduction for oneself; the precursor to the modern business card
- Business card, a small card with business information that is given for convenience and as a memory aid
- Tart card, an ad stuck to a phone box to advertise the services of a call girl
- Calling card (crime), a signature token or characteristic of a crime used by a serial criminal
- Telephone card, a small card, usually resembling a credit card, used to pay for telephone services
- Slang for bird feces, especially when landing in an undesirable place.
- Calling Card, a 1976 album by Irish blues-rock musician Rory Gallagher
